Top 3 Strikers Tottenham Should Target In January Including The Leicester City Hitman

Share

Tottenham have amassed a good unbeaten run of 11 games so far in the PL and blowing away this start in the latter half of the season would result in missing out on a top 4 spot. This season Kane did take a while to rediscover his scoring form that made him such a sensation last season. Touchwood nothing happens to him but there is a possibility of him falling into another dry patch or getting injured or fatigue issues due to being over used as he is the only out and out striker in the squad. Therefore the North Londoners should look at options for back up strikers.

Jamie Vardy:

The England and Leicester City man has been in superb form this season, scoring in 9 consecutive games so far matching Rudd Van Nistelrooy’s record. The player will be costly and should cost easily about 20M but will be a great back up option but seems quite ridiculous that Vardy would settle for a back up spot and also Spurs shelling so much cash for a back up striker too. Yet, surely a player that has to be on their radar.

Luuk De Jong:

The Dutchman experienced couple of bad years since he first came into the spotlight and injuries really did not help his case. His first outing in the PL with Newcastle was a horror show, but who has performed to their potential at Newcastle in recent times barring Sissokho? Again, he may not settle for a back up role in the squad right when he has the chance to grab the lead striker role for Nederland’s with regular football. But the attraction of the PL could play a key role in bagging the player for Spurs. Hardworking, team player and good finisher cum poacher he is quite similar to Kane in terms of playing style.

Odion Ighalo:

So far scoring 7 goals, the Nigerian has been on song for Watford in the PL this season. Surely a player who will want to make a move to a bigger club and will not mind playing cup games and as a back up striker. Not exactly a proven goal scorer in the PL but with better service he will receive at Spurs, he could very well be a good striker option to have in the squad.

January will be a key period on and off the pitch for Spurs. And to keep the good run going after January, the back up has to be bought. Son and N’Jie are available but both are primarily wingers who can play both as attacking mids or false 9s. An out and out striker to back Kane up is essential and adding another attacking option to the squad is much needed to keep a good cup run and challenging for Top 4.
